LPM CAMPUS – Data shows that the scale of ecological damage on the ground is becoming increasingly massive. The National Disaster Management Agency (BNPB) detected 1,487 hotspots in Kalimantan as of August 19, 2026. Monitoring by the Nusantara Atlas platform confirms that the total area burned throughout 2026 has exceeded 285,000 hectares, with 182,000 hectares of that burned in the month of July alone. Findings from Greenpeace Indonesia further underscore this crisis after identifying 592 sources of smoke, 455 of which are concentrated in highly vulnerable peatland landscapes. The drying of peat domes due to extreme weather accelerates the spread of fire, while also hindering the reach of firefighting crews in isolated areas.

The widespread forest and land fires (Karhutla) at several peatland sites across Kalimantan suddenly drew widespread public attention after video footage of the conditions on the ground went viral on social media. Footage showing thick smoke that limited the visibility of drivers on interprovincial highways sparked widespread public concern. In response to the escalating ecological crisis, the Joint Task Force, together with law enforcement and local government officials, moved quickly to step up emergency response efforts and investigate potential legal violations behind this annual disaster.

The expansion of the burned areas has had a direct impact on a drastic decline in air quality in various residential areas. Based on measurements of the Air Pollutant Standard Index (ISPU), several inland and urban areas have recorded air quality levels ranging from “Very Unhealthy” to “Dangerous” for human health. The thick haze not only disrupts the flow of land transportation and domestic flights but also triggers a surge in cases of Acute Respiratory Infections (ARI) at various local health facilities. In fact, the spread of this forest and land fire smoke has the potential to continue expanding, affecting air quality in neighboring countries—which has led to the temporary closure of hundreds of schools in Malaysia due to smoke exposure from Kalimantan.

On the front lines of firefighting, a joint team of personnel from Manggala Agni (Ministry of Environment and Forestry), the Indonesian National Armed Forces (TNI), the Indonesian National Police (Polri), the Regional Disaster Management Agency (BPBD), and volunteers are racing against time to navigate extreme terrain and extinguish peat fires that have spread several meters below the ground’s surface. The nature of underground fires—which easily reignite when blown by strong winds—and the limited water supply in this arid area have forced ground teams to work overtime into the night to contain the flames and prevent them from spreading to residential areas. To overcome the limitations of ground access, the government deployed water-bombing helicopters to douse isolated hotspots from the air, while simultaneously preparing a Weather Modification Technology (TMC) operation to moisten the dried-out peat domes. This combination of ground patrols and aerial intervention is the Task Force’s primary strategy for curbing the spread of new hotspots.

To protect the public from exposure to hazardous smoke, local authorities have declared a Forest and Land Fire Emergency Alert Status, accompanied by preventive measures such as shifting in-person learning to distance learning (PJJ) and distributing free masks in public spaces. This declaration provides budgetary flexibility and enables the mobilization of personnel to address ecological impacts on the ground. However, a number of environmental observers believe that this emergency response policy, which is repeated every year, indicates a lack of early prevention strategies. The escalation of the disaster—now widely exposed on social media—should not only be addressed with symptomatic measures but should also serve as a catalyst for non-discriminatory law enforcement against corporations responsible for triggering the fires. The success of this crisis response can no longer be measured solely by how quickly the fires are extinguished, but rather by how boldly all stakeholders fundamentally reform peatland management to permanently break the cycle of haze disasters.
